Method: To this end, a mixture design using an efficient experiment methodology was constructed, with the aim of optimizing three responses of interest: pH, humidity, and organic matter of the 25 formulations. Results: The optimal composition was comprised of organic and green household waste (56.7%), olive mill waste cake residues (21.7%) and poultry droppings (21.7%). These analyses were followed by the evolution of some physio-chemical parameters such as pH, temperature, organic matter, C/N ratio and polyphenols until they are stabilized. In addition, using spectroscopic analysis, maturation and phytotoxicity tests were carried out on the germinating cress. Conclusion: The results of this research indicated the achievement of an ideal composition of an adequate mixture that had the characteristics of an organic amendment, non-phytotoxic and in conformity with the NFU-44-051 that led to mature compost.   Article Highlights Valorization of olive mill waste cake residue was achieved after oil extraction by co-composting.
